Introduction

To provide a professional technical guidance, with full responsibility and accountability, to ensure that the Quality Management System is well implemented within the offshore EPIC Projects.

What are you going to do

  • To ensure and monitor full compliance to company Standards, Shell Dep's, and applicable International Codes throughout the performed projects, which shall be addressed in the relevant Project Quality Plans (PQP).
  • Prepare the Project QMS documentation in accordance with QatarEnergy requirements.
  • Manage and follow-up on implementation of QMS compliance requirements in Contracts.
  • Act as a PMT Focal Point for Corporate/external audits. Coordinate with Project Team and EBS for planning and conducting QatarEnergy second party audits on Contractors and participate in assigned audits during contracts execution.
  • Guide subordinates (call-off) and Project Team on various activities related to latest version of ISO 9001 Standard, QMS system documentation and certification requirements.
  • Prepare Project Quality Plan (PQP) in coordination with the Project Team. Ensure that EPIC Contractors required Project Quality Plan (PQP) is established and adhered to throughout the Project Life Cycle.
  • Review the EPIC Scope of Services (SOS) and Scope of Work (SOW) and ensure that QatarEnergy quality and technical requirements are incorporated which include
  • Contractor/Supplier's QA/QC and relevant engineering and construction deliverables and any other Technical / QatarEnergy System documents.
  • Participate in pre-qualification of EPIC Contractors/Sub-Contractors and Vendors, as required, monitor and enforce compliance with ISO 9001, QP-QAL-STD-004, QatarEnergy PML/SML, etc.
  • Participate in EPIC technical bid evaluation of the Bidders to ensure that QatarEnergy quality requirements as per QP-QAL-STD-004 are included, addressed, and understood.
  • Review Contractor/Supplier's engineering and construction deliverables with specific emphasis to QA/QC and coordinate with relevant engineering discipline specialists on issues related to materials/corrosion/special processes etc.; to enforce compliance to contract requirements.
  • Ensure deviation & non-conformance control system is implemented to meet the departmental compliance requirements. Verify the resolution of deviations related to corrective and preventive actions and proper closure of NCRs and CARs.
  • Lead multi-discipline QA/QC Team (call-off) within the Project Teams and ensure that the Inspection Test Plans and procedures are in place and adhered to throughout the project life cycle.

Essential skills and knowledge 

  • Bachelor's degree in an Engineering discipline from an internationally recognized
  • University, preferably a Mechanical degree. Master's degree is also preferable.
  • Membership of a recognised Professional Institution of relevance is preferable.
  • Minimum fifteen (15) years of relevant QA/QC experience in Oil & Gas projects, including a solid offshore experience, minimum 5 years in similar senior position.
  • Qualified as Lead ISO 9001 Auditor. Professional qualifications relevant to quality is desirable. Working knowledge and experience with international codes and standards relevant to quality.
  • Familiar with development of quality management systems, quality assurance & control relevant to Oil and Gas or Infrastructure and Civil projects during engineering development, procurement, construction & commissioning.
  • Working knowledge in the manufacturing inspection and certification processes for
  • equipment/ materials in projects and the associated Quality Assurance and Quality Control practices.
  • Working knowledge in offshore construction, welding & NDE (conventional and nonconventional techniques) is essential.
  • Proficient in the English language (both written & spoken).
  • Leadership skills to motivate and organise Project and Contractors quality & Inspection Teams to achieve a high-performance level.
